Tammy the therapy dog

I have to say this is a dream come true for Me and a couple coworkers. Tammy went through training all summer to become a St. John's therapy dog. She had to meet a strict criteria of prerequisites in order to be able to be registered as a therapy dog.

For a few of us the inspiration came from the program see spot read , as well as an up and running program collaborated between the Winnipeg humane society and libraries.

Tammy comes into our classroom for one period every day 1. Her owner, Mrs. Beaumont is also a resource teacher at our school, brings Tammy in to visit us.

She comes again this Wednesday. Fr our activity we will be learning a new sight word -LIKE. Students are asked to bring in some thing they like, and Tammy is going to bring some things she likes!!!
